Aster Cuts Token Emissions by 97% as It Shifts to Staking Only Rewards Model
In a significant move aimed at stabilizing its cryptocurrency ecosystem, Aster has announced a substantial reduction in its token emissions, slashing them by a staggering 97%. This decision is part of a broader strategy to transition to a staking-only rewards model, fundamentally changing how users can benefit from holding Aster tokens.
The shift to a staking-only rewards system means that rewards will now exclusively come from staking activities, rather than traditional token unlocks that may have created excess supply in the marketplace. This change results in a drastic cut to the monthly token unlocking, effectively alleviating supply pressure.
